Best Practices for Shift Swapping in Small Hotels

To maximize the benefits of shift swapping while minimizing potential challenges, Memphis hotel operators should adopt industry best practices tailored to the unique characteristics of small hospitality businesses. These strategies ensure that shift swapping enhances operational flexibility without compromising service quality or creating administrative burdens.

  • Establish Time Parameters: Require shift swap requests to be submitted at least 24-48 hours in advance, with emergency exceptions requiring manager approval.
  • Create Approval Hierarchies: Implement a tiered approval system where routine swaps might receive automatic approval while others require management review.
  • Set Qualification Requirements: Ensure that employees can only swap shifts with colleagues who possess the necessary skills for their position, particularly for specialized roles.
  • Monitor Frequency: Track how often individual employees participate in shift swaps to identify potential scheduling issues or policy abuse.
  • Provide Clear Documentation: Maintain comprehensive records of all shift swaps for payroll accuracy, regulatory compliance, and performance evaluation.

Successful Memphis hotel operators often create a shift marketplace where employees can post and claim available shifts, streamlining the process while maintaining management visibility. Additionally, implementing a system that considers employee preferences and historical performance can further enhance the effectiveness of your shift swapping program.

Legal and Compliance Considerations in Memphis

Memphis hotel operators must navigate various legal and regulatory requirements when implementing shift swapping programs. Tennessee labor laws, federal regulations, and industry-specific standards all impact how shift swapping should be structured and documented to maintain compliance while providing flexibility.

  •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A): Ensure shift swaps don’t create overtime liability by carefully tracking hours worked, particularly when swaps occur across different workweeks.
  • Tennessee Labor Regulations: Be aware of state-specific requirements regarding work hours, break periods, and scheduling notice that may affect shift swapping policies.
  • Record-Keeping Requirements: Maintain detailed documentation of all shift swaps, including who worked when, for at least three years to comply with federal and state requirements.
  • Minor Employment Restrictions: If your Memphis hotel employs workers under 18, ensure shift swaps comply with stricter scheduling limitations for minors.
  • Equal Opportunity Considerations: Apply shift swapping policies consistently to avoid discriminatory practices that could violate equal employment opportunity laws.

While Memphis doesn’t currently have specific predictable scheduling laws like some other cities, hotel operators should stay informed about potential regulatory changes. Working with legal counsel to review your shift swapping policies can help ensure compliance while still providing the flexibility that benefits both your business and employees. 5. How should we handle employees who frequently request shift swaps?

When employees consistently request shift swaps, first analyze patterns to identify underlying causes—there may be legitimate recurring commitments or potential issues with your core scheduling approach. For Memphis hotel staff with ongoing scheduling challenges, consider adjusting their standard schedule rather than relying on continuous swapping. Establish reasonable limits on swap frequency and implement a graduated oversight system where frequent requesters receive additional scrutiny. Some hotels use a “swap bank” concept that limits the number of swaps per period while allowing flexibility for occasional needs. Balance accommodation with operational requirements, and always ensure that frequent swapping doesn’t create inequitable work distribution or scheduling advantages for certain staff members.
